**Runbook: Tenant Quota Bumps (Meterloft)**

Quick one for the sync: per-tenant rate quotas live in Meterloft's admin plane, not in code. Bumping a quota needs a signed request, so set up your local `.env` first — copy `env.example`, fill in the region, then append the admin signing secret on the next line:

env line for kaguf-hahop: COURIER_KEY29=2e2fa9479f98362396e2c28f86fc9

# Break-Glass: Catalog Cache Invalidation

Scope: the Pinrow product catalog at Veldstone Retail. If stale prices persist after a purge and the Hollowmere invalidation queue is wedged, use break-glass to flush the edge tier directly. Contractors: get verbal sign-off from the catalog lead first. Steps: open the Hollowmere admin shell, select emergency-flush, confirm the tenant, and run it once — repeated flushes thrash the origin. Access is logged and expires after 20 minutes. Unseal the admin shell with the passphrase below.

recovery phrase for kahop-tajog: istix-casvan

## Configuration

Fixturecraft is our test-data factory library. It generates deterministic records from seeded templates and never touches production datastores. For the security review: seeds are local, but anonymization templates are fetched from the Velmora template registry at startup. Configure `FIXTURECRAFT_SEED=4021` in `.env.test`, then supply the registry credential on the following line:

vault entry, yahif-yajep: COURIER_KEY29=b802bdf8034096b65a51c6ba5abe2

## Runbook: Log sampling — Chirpfeed ingest

Chirpfeed ingest logs everything at debug. Unsampled, it floods the aggregator within minutes. Sampling is mandatory in prod. Do not set the rate to 1.0, ever. If you need full logs for an incident, raise sampling on a single pod only, max 15 minutes, then revert. The standard production sampling config is below.

settings of bawif-fawif:
ralix:
  log_level: warn
  metrics_host: metrics.ralix.tolvaqsys.internal
  pool_size: 32